Four operators, at least four towercos, and five years to achieve 60% coverage from a very low baseline… Ready steady go!

The race is on to deliver coverage and capacity to the virgin territory of Myanmar. Multiple towercos are jostling for clusters of towers handed out by two international and two local operators. Local ICT experience is scarce; a lot of knowledge and equipment must be imported. Electricity and transport infrastructure are under-developed. Myanmar is not a tower market for the feint-hearted, but the opportunity may be as great as any in the global tower industry. TowerXchange takes a first look...

The attractiveness of Myanmar, one of the last green field mobile markets in the world, led to a fierce battle for two recently issued mobile licenses.
